This evocative photograph captures the essence of Clacton-on-Sea, Essex in 1918. The image shows the iconic pier stretching out into the North Sea, with the gentle curve of the beach and the rolling waves in the background. The pier, a popular destination for visitors since its construction in 1871, stands as a testament to the town's rich maritime history. In this photograph, the pier appears almost deserted, with only a few figures visible on the beach and a solitary fisherman casting his line from the end of the pier. The absence of crowds and the serene atmosphere create a sense of tranquility and reflection. The year 1918 holds significant historical importance for Clacton-on-Sea and the wider world. The First World War had ended just a few months earlier, and the town, like many others, was beginning to recover from the devastating impact of the conflict. The photograph serves as a poignant reminder of the town's resilience and its ability to rebuild and move forward. The pier, which has undergone numerous renovations and extensions over the years, remains a cherished part of Clacton-on-Sea's identity. Today, it continues to attract visitors from far and wide, offering a range of amenities, from amusement arcades and fairground rides to restaurants and boat trips. This photograph, taken over a century ago, provides a fascinating glimpse into the past and the enduring appeal of this quintessentially British seaside town.
